Original Description
De Scott Evans' Arranging Roses (1892) transports viewers into an intimate domestic moment suffused with Victorian elegance and quiet lyricism. The painting captures a young woman gently tending to a bouquet of lush roses, her demeanor focused yet serene amidst the play of natural light filtering through gauzy curtains. Executed with meticulous realism characteristic of late 19th-century Academic painting, Evans showcases his mastery in rendering textures—from the delicate petals to the sheen of porcelain and fabric. Though less renowned than his trompe-l'œil works, this piece reflects the era’s fascination with floral symbolism and idealized femininity, bridging the gap between sentimental genre scenes and emerging Impressionist lightness. Its historical significance lies in encapsulating Gilded Age aesthetics while hinting at subtle narratives of domesticity and refinement.
